Lucy, My Sister

BY MARIAN PARTINGTON

Brief Description:
This is a harrowing essay first published as a feature in the British Guardian newspaper. Partington, a Quaker, tells how she struggled with extremes of grief, anger and bitterness when she found out her sister Lucy, missing for 20 yeas, had been kidnapped, tortured and killed by Britain's mot notorious serial killers Fred and Rosemary West. She had to cope with the trial and prurient media coverage of their crimes. This is the story of a Quaker confronting ultimate evil on a personal basis.

Britain Yearly Meeting 2003 32 PP. Paper
